Associate Director of Child Development Center

Triton College is seeking an Associate Director for their Child Development Center. The role involves providing an optimal learning environment for children and assisting the director in supervising staff and developing community reputation through various events and training.

Responsibilities

Reviews weekly lesson plans and resource units for all the classrooms in the Child Development Center. Provides feedback to teachers and assists in training and supporting developmentally appropriate curriculum in the classrooms
Conducts weekly meetings with student teachers to plan weekly activities, provides resources and serves as a coach to support their continued learning and success at the Child Development Center
Assists the director in advising and evaluating student teachers. through informal, daily conversations and formally through an evaluation which is shared with students
Coordinates parent-teacher conferences for the Child Development Center each semester and provides support to the teachers conducting the conferences as needed. Maintains daily contacts with parents/caregivers to ensure the safety of participants, handle special circumstance and ensure resolution of parent concerns. Communicates and follows up with parents, staff, and administration on any issues that were addressed
Ensure that assessments are scheduled and completed for the individual, cognitive, and social/emotional needs of all children. Ensure an understanding of the Ages and Stages Questionnaire for both toddlers and preschool children. Serve as a coach to new teachers to train and conduct assessments with teachers as needed
Assists the teacher and director in the general layout of the classroom and various learning/activity areas. , including S.T.E.A.M. curriculum areas
Responsible with the director to ensure that all medicines are administered to children as needed. Follows up with families to ensure that all doctor notes and medication administration forms are completed by the families before administering medication (including sunscreen and bug spray)
Coordinates field trips for the Child Development Center and creates a summer monthly activities calendar. Is responsible for obtaining supplies and implementing these activities in conjunction with the classroom teachers
Maintains a healthy, safe, and clean environment for all children. Takes the lead role as the Safety Coordinator for the school, ensuring that new staff and students are trained on school health and safety procedures. Ensures that monthly fire drills are completed. Ensures that tornado drills and safety drills are completed two times annually. Keeps a record of staff CPR and First Aid training and ensures staff renewals are completed on time. Schedules safety trainings for staff, including Blood Borne Pathogens, Epi-Pens, Fire Extinguisher, and other related trainings
Leads daily learning activities, naps, and exercises. and all other required teacher job functions while covering the various classrooms
Ensures that the center meets DCFS, IDHS, CACFP, and NAEYC Regulations
Responsible, in conjunction with the Director, for maintaining, recording, and submitting Illinois Department of Human Services grant materials and forms
Responsible, in conjunction with the Director, for coordinating all meals and snacks with an outside catering agency. Report’s school closures in a timely manner and keeps an accurate record of food received and served through the food program
Arranges accurate billing and timely collection of tuition and maintains tuition records. in conjunction with the Office Assistant and Director
Responsible for assisting with the dissemination of announcements and notifications to families, staff, and administrators via phone, print, and automated messaging systems
Responsible for promoting the school at Triton College and in the community. Reviews correspondence and flyers before they leave the school and makes sure that all parent manuals, tuition sheets, and marketing materials are updated and accurate
Performs other job-related duties as necessary and as assigned by supervisor

Qualification

Early Childhood EducationChild DevelopmentCPR CertificationFirst Aid CertificationCommunication Skills

Required

Bachelor's degree in Early Childhood Education
Minimum of one year of experience working with children 15 months – 5-years-old
